| /** | |
| * PDF Viewer Component | |
| * | |
| * Initializes PDF.js viewers for PDF display fields. | |
| * Supports text layer for span annotation. | |
| */ | |
| // PDF.js library is loaded from CDN | |
| const PDFJS_CDN = 'https://cdnjs.cloudflare.com/ajax/libs/pdf.js/3.11.174'; | |
| // Track initialized viewers | |
| const pdfViewers = new Map(); | |
| /** | |
| * Initialize all PDF viewers on the page. | |
| */ | |
| function initPDFViewers() { | |
| const containers = document.querySelectorAll('.pdf-display[data-pdf-source]'); | |
| containers.forEach(container => { | |
| if (!pdfViewers.has(container)) { | |
| const viewer = new PDFViewer(container); | |
| pdfViewers.set(container, viewer); | |
| } | |
| }); | |
| } | |
| /** | |
| * PDF Viewer class | |
| */ | |
| class PDFViewer { | |
| constructor(container) { | |
| this.container = container; | |
| this.pdfSource = container.dataset.pdfSource; | |
| this.viewMode = container.dataset.viewMode || 'scroll'; | |
| this.textLayerEnabled = container.dataset.textLayer === 'true'; | |
| this.initialPage = parseInt(container.dataset.initialPage) || 1; | |
| this.zoom = container.dataset.zoom || 'auto'; | |
| this.pdfDoc = null; | |
| this.currentPage = this.initialPage; | |
| this.totalPages = 0; | |
| this.scale = 1.0; | |
| this.rendering = false; | |
| this.pageNumPending = null; | |
| // DOM elements | |
| this.canvas = container.querySelector('.pdf-canvas'); | |
| this.canvasContainer = container.querySelector('.pdf-canvas-container'); | |
| this.textLayer = container.querySelector('.pdf-text-layer'); | |
| this.loadingEl = container.querySelector('.pdf-loading'); | |
| this.errorEl = container.querySelector('.pdf-error'); | |
| this.currentPageEl = container.querySelector('.pdf-current-page'); | |
| this.totalPagesEl = container.querySelector('.pdf-total-pages'); | |
| this.prevBtn = container.querySelector('.pdf-prev-btn'); | |
| this.nextBtn = container.querySelector('.pdf-next-btn'); | |
| this.zoomSelect = container.querySelector('.pdf-zoom-select'); | |
| this.ctx = this.canvas ? this.canvas.getContext('2d') : null; | |
| this.init(); | |
| } | |
| async init() { | |
| try { | |
| await this.loadPDFJS(); | |
| await this.loadDocument(); | |
| } catch (error) { | |
| this.showError(error.message); | |
| } | |
| } | |
| /** | |
| * Load PDF.js library dynamically if not already loaded. | |
| */ | |
| async loadPDFJS() { | |
| if (window.pdfjsLib) { | |
| return; | |
| } | |
| return new Promise((resolve, reject) => { | |
| const script = document.createElement('script'); | |
| script.src = `${PDFJS_CDN}/pdf.min.js`; | |
| script.onload = () => { | |
| // Set worker source | |
| window.pdfjsLib.GlobalWorkerOptions.workerSrc = | |
| `${PDFJS_CDN}/pdf.worker.min.js`; | |
| resolve(); | |
| }; | |
| script.onerror = () => reject(new Error('Failed to load PDF.js')); | |
| document.head.appendChild(script); | |
| }); | |
| } | |
| /** | |
| * Load the PDF document. | |
| */ | |
| async loadDocument() { | |
| this.showLoading(true); | |
| try { | |
| const loadingTask = pdfjsLib.getDocument(this.pdfSource); | |
| this.pdfDoc = await loadingTask.promise; | |
| this.totalPages = this.pdfDoc.numPages; | |
| // Update UI | |
| if (this.totalPagesEl) { | |
| this.totalPagesEl.textContent = this.totalPages; | |
| } | |
| // Set up controls | |
| this.setupControls(); | |
| // Render initial page | |
| await this.renderPage(this.currentPage); | |
| this.showLoading(false); | |
| } catch (error) { | |
| console.error('PDF load error:', error); | |
| throw new Error(`Failed to load PDF: ${error.message}`); | |
| } | |
| } | |
| /** | |
| * Set up page navigation and zoom controls. | |
| */ | |
| setupControls() { | |
| if (this.prevBtn) { | |
| this.prevBtn.addEventListener('click', () => this.prevPage()); | |
| } | |
| if (this.nextBtn) { | |
| this.nextBtn.addEventListener('click', () => this.nextPage()); | |
| } | |
| if (this.zoomSelect) { | |
| this.zoomSelect.value = this.zoom; | |
| this.zoomSelect.addEventListener('change', (e) => { | |
| this.setZoom(e.target.value); | |
| }); | |
| } | |
| // Keyboard navigation | |
| this.container.addEventListener('keydown', (e) => { | |
| if (e.key === 'ArrowLeft' || e.key === 'PageUp') { | |
| this.prevPage(); | |
| } else if (e.key === 'ArrowRight' || e.key === 'PageDown') { | |
| this.nextPage(); | |
| } | |
| }); | |
| } | |
| /** | |
| * Render a specific page. | |
| */ | |
| async renderPage(pageNum) { | |
| if (!this.pdfDoc || !this.canvas) return; | |
| if (this.rendering) { | |
| this.pageNumPending = pageNum; | |
| return; | |
| } | |
| this.rendering = true; | |
| this.currentPage = pageNum; | |
| try { | |
| const page = await this.pdfDoc.getPage(pageNum); | |
| // Calculate scale | |
| const containerWidth = this.canvasContainer?.offsetWidth || 600; | |
| let scale = this.calculateScale(page, containerWidth); | |
| const viewport = page.getViewport({ scale }); | |
| // Set canvas dimensions | |
| this.canvas.height = viewport.height; | |
| this.canvas.width = viewport.width; | |
| // Render page | |
| const renderContext = { | |
| canvasContext: this.ctx, | |
| viewport: viewport | |
| }; | |
| await page.render(renderContext).promise; | |
| // Render text layer if enabled | |
| if (this.textLayerEnabled && this.textLayer) { | |
| await this.renderTextLayer(page, viewport); | |
| } | |
| // Update page display | |
| if (this.currentPageEl) { | |
| this.currentPageEl.textContent = pageNum; | |
| } | |
| // Update button states | |
| this.updateButtonStates(); | |
| } catch (error) { | |
| console.error('Page render error:', error); | |
| } finally { | |
| this.rendering = false; | |
| // Render pending page if any | |
| if (this.pageNumPending !== null) { | |
| const pending = this.pageNumPending; | |
| this.pageNumPending = null; | |
| this.renderPage(pending); | |
| } | |
| } | |
| } | |
| /** | |
| * Calculate scale based on zoom setting. | |
| */ | |
| calculateScale(page, containerWidth) { | |
| const viewport = page.getViewport({ scale: 1 }); | |
| switch (this.zoom) { | |
| case 'auto': | |
| case 'page-width': | |
| return containerWidth / viewport.width; | |
| case 'page-fit': | |
| const containerHeight = this.container.offsetHeight || 600; | |
| const scaleX = containerWidth / viewport.width; | |
| const scaleY = containerHeight / viewport.height; | |
| return Math.min(scaleX, scaleY); | |
| default: | |
| const parsed = parseFloat(this.zoom); | |
| return isNaN(parsed) ? 1.0 : parsed; | |
| } | |
| } | |
| /** | |
| * Render the text layer for selection and annotation. | |
| */ | |
| async renderTextLayer(page, viewport) { | |
| const textContent = await page.getTextContent(); | |
| // Clear existing text layer | |
| this.textLayer.innerHTML = ''; | |
| this.textLayer.style.width = `${viewport.width}px`; | |
| this.textLayer.style.height = `${viewport.height}px`; | |
| // Use PDF.js text layer rendering | |
| const textLayerFragment = document.createDocumentFragment(); | |
| textContent.items.forEach((item, index) => { | |
| const tx = pdfjsLib.Util.transform( | |
| viewport.transform, | |
| item.transform | |
| ); | |
| const span = document.createElement('span'); | |
| span.textContent = item.str; | |
| span.style.left = `${tx[4]}px`; | |
| span.style.top = `${tx[5]}px`; | |
| span.style.fontSize = `${Math.abs(tx[0])}px`; | |
| span.style.fontFamily = item.fontName || 'sans-serif'; | |
| span.dataset.index = index; | |
| textLayerFragment.appendChild(span); | |
| }); | |
| this.textLayer.appendChild(textLayerFragment); | |
| } | |
| /** | |
| * Navigate to previous page. | |
| */ | |
| prevPage() { | |
| if (this.currentPage > 1) { | |
| this.renderPage(this.currentPage - 1); | |
| } | |
| } | |
| /** | |
| * Navigate to next page. | |
| */ | |
| nextPage() { | |
| if (this.currentPage < this.totalPages) { | |
| this.renderPage(this.currentPage + 1); | |
| } | |
| } | |
| /** | |
| * Go to a specific page. | |
| */ | |
| goToPage(pageNum) { | |
| if (pageNum >= 1 && pageNum <= this.totalPages) { | |
| this.renderPage(pageNum); | |
| } | |
| } | |
| /** | |
| * Set zoom level. | |
| */ | |
| setZoom(zoom) { | |
| this.zoom = zoom; | |
| this.renderPage(this.currentPage); | |
| } | |
| /** | |
| * Update navigation button states. | |
| */ | |
| updateButtonStates() { | |
| if (this.prevBtn) { | |
| this.prevBtn.disabled = this.currentPage <= 1; | |
| } | |
| if (this.nextBtn) { | |
| this.nextBtn.disabled = this.currentPage >= this.totalPages; | |
| } | |
| } | |
| /** | |
| * Show/hide loading indicator. | |
| */ | |
| showLoading(show) { | |
| if (this.loadingEl) { | |
| this.loadingEl.style.display = show ? 'flex' : 'none'; | |
| } | |
| } | |
| /** | |
| * Show error message. | |
| */ | |
| showError(message) { | |
| this.showLoading(false); | |
| if (this.errorEl) { | |
| this.errorEl.textContent = message; | |
| this.errorEl.style.display = 'block'; | |
| } | |
| } | |
| /** | |
| * Clean up resources. | |
| */ | |
| destroy() { | |
| if (this.pdfDoc) { | |
| this.pdfDoc.destroy(); | |
| this.pdfDoc = null; | |
| } | |
| pdfViewers.delete(this.container); | |
| } | |
| } | |
| // Auto-initialize on DOM ready | |
| if (document.readyState === 'loading') { | |
| document.addEventListener('DOMContentLoaded', initPDFViewers); | |
| } else { | |
| initPDFViewers(); | |
| } | |
| // Re-initialize when new content is loaded (for dynamic updates) | |
| document.addEventListener('potato:content-loaded', initPDFViewers); | |
| // Export for external use | |
| window.PDFViewer = PDFViewer; | |
| window.initPDFViewers = initPDFViewers; | |
